Hi Milly,
The following is very speculative, and is drawn solely form my armchair searchings after reading your Opening Post.
I can see there’s a 1966 death registered at the NSW BDM online index for a Wallace Robert BERRY, with parents as John Henry and Grace Ann. The death was registered at Wallsend (#21255)
Provided the informant gave the correct given names for his parents, then perhaps his parents married at Quirindi in 1904 …. Perhaps their marriage was registered there, in 1904. I can see on the index that there’s a marriage for a John H BERRY and a Grace A TICKLE (#4748). That marriage certificate would confirm the details that John and Grace provided about themselves AND their respective parents. (where/when born/occupation etc for the bride and groom and parents names/occupations and former names etc). The same information is also available in official transcriptions. These are cheaper than and arrive quicker than the NSW BDM real deal certificate.
I cannot see a birth registered for Wallace Robert, so it seems to me that if his parents were John and Grace, that your Wallace may well have older siblings. I would also suspect that he was born more recently than 1912, as the NSW BDM restricts access to births less than 100 years ago (marriages less than 50 years ago, deaths less than 30 years ago).
